Output 72ec626c77007bd2613e64e7641ad4d5df69b14f232091fdca78371fe26181e5:2

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b6404810b24ab5291f730df53e7de317320c29aee5b5e5c04e2af0b36f3335a
address
tb1pddjqfqgtyj449y0hxr048e77x9ejps56aed4uhqyu2hskdhnxddqksg8nf
transaction
72ec626c77007bd2613e64e7641ad4d5df69b14f232091fdca78371fe26181e5